/*!https://www.topstallingen.nl/?occss=1&time=1765685&ver=6.9*/@media (max-width: 767px) {
    .onw-home-header {
        background-image: url(https://www.topstallingen.nl/wp-content/uploads/2021/11/Topstallingen-header-e1636119464565.jpg)!important;
    }
}

#top .av-main-nav ul a {
    padding: 10px 15px;
    color: #333;
    font-size: 1em;
    font-weight: 600;
}

#top #header .av-main-nav > li > a .avia-menu-text, #top #header .av-main-nav > li > a .avia-menu-subtext {
    font-size: 1.2em;
}

.avia_button_icon.avia_button_icon_right {
    padding-right: 59% !important;
}

.fa-star:before {
    content: "\f005";
    color: #eeee22;
}

.fa-star-half-alt:before {
    content: "\f5c0";
    color: #eeee22;
}

.avia_button_background.avia-button.avia-button-fullwidth.avia-color-theme-color {
    display: none;
}

#top .avia-button {
    padding: 12px !important;
    font-size: 1.1em !important;
}

.template-page {
    margin-top: 0!important;
}

#stallingen .avia_image {
    height: 200px;
    object-fit: cover;
}

#stallingen h3 {
    min-height: 46px;
}

.onw-homepage-center-align-columns .entry-content-wrapper {
    display: flex;
    flex-wrap: wrap;
    align-items: center;
}

@media (max-width: 767px) {
    div .flex_column {
        width: 100%;
        margin: 0;
    }

    .container {
        padding: 0;
        width: 85%;
    }
}

.fullsize .content {
    margin: 0;
}

/* Popup */
body .magic-popups-popup {
    top: unset!important;
    left: unset!important;
    bottom: 0;
    right: 0;
    width: auto!important;
    height: auto!important;
    padding: 0!important;
    box-shadow: 0 -5px 20px rgba(0,0,0,.04), 0 -3px 6px rgba(0,0,0,.07);
}
/* END Popup */